ORDER
The Disciplinary Review Board having filed with the Court its decision in DRB 03-117, concluding that ELLIOTT D. MOORMAN of EAST ORANGE, who was admitted to the bar of this State in 1977, and who has been suspended from the practice of law since February 28, 2003, pursuant to Orders of this Court filed January 30, 2003, and June 26, 2003, should be reprimanded for violating RPC 1.1(a) (gross neglect), RPC 1.3 (lack of diligence);
And respondent having failed to appear on the return date of the Order to Show Cause issued in this matter;
And the Court having determined based on the misconduct in this matter and respondent's history of unethical conduct that a term of suspension is the appropriate discipline for respondent's misconduct and that have the period of suspension should be consecutive to the three-month term of suspension imposed effective May 28, 2003;
And good cause appearing;
It is ORDERED that ELLIOTT D. MOORMAN is suspended from the practice of law for a period of one year and until the further Order of the Court, effective August 28, 2003; and it is further
ORDERED that the entire record of this matter be made a permanent part of respondent's file as an attorney at law of this State; and it is further
ORDERED that respondent continue to be restrained and enjoined from practicing law during the period of suspension and that respondent continue to comply with Rule 1:20-20; and it is further
ORDERED that respondent reimburse the Disciplinary Oversight Committee for appropriate administrative costs incurred in the prosecution of this matter.
